[Bug 1245531] [NEW] Ubiquity does not respect preseed 'file=' parameter

Ubuntu 13.10 amd64 (Also occurs on Kubuntu/Lubuntu)

I attempt to start an automatic installation by passing in boot
parameters:

automatic-ubiquity file=/path/to/custom/preseed.cfg  debian-
installer/locale=en_US.UTF-8 keyboard-configuration/layoutcode=us
keyboard-configuration/variantcode=

However, the installer starts in the normal manual mode.  The automatic
installer launches as expected when using the parameter debian-installer
/custom-installation=/path/to/custom-install/ where  custom-install/
contains the preseed file.
